| Date | Name | Activity | Value | 
|---|---|---|---|
| Nov 19, 2024 | xxxxxxxxxxxxx | $558600 | |
| Nov 18, 2024 | xxxxxxxxxxxxx | $148586 | |
| Nov 18, 2024 | xxxxxxxxxxxxx | $1032726 | |
| Nov 18, 2024 | xxxxxxxxxxxxx | $1042250 | 
| Date | Firm | Activity | Value | 
|---|---|---|---|
| Jun 30, 2025 | xxxxxxxxxxxxx | $928238 | |
| Jun 30, 2025 | xxxxxxxxxxxxx | $26333000 | |
| Jun 30, 2025 | xxxxxxxxxxxxx | $107673793 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 22,494,237 | Institution | 10.51% | 424,916,137 | |
| 18,181,789 | Institution | 8.50% | 343,453,994 | |
| 10,282,674 | Insider | 5.00% | 194,239,712 | |
| 7,301,010 | Institution | 3.41% | 137,916,079 | |
| 6,951,181 | Institution | 3.25% | 131,307,809 | |
| 5,422,703 | Insider | 2.60% | 102,434,860 | |
| 3,927,223 | Institution | 1.84% | 74,185,242 | |
| 3,865,045 | Institution | 1.81% | 73,010,700 | |
| 2,426,036 | Insider | 1.13% | 45,827,820 | |
| 2,065,849 | Institution | 0.97% | 39,023,888 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 18,181,789 | Institution | 8.50% | 343,453,994 | |
| 3,927,223 | Institution | 1.84% | 74,185,242 | |
| 3,865,045 | Institution | 1.81% | 73,010,700 | |
| 2,065,849 | Institution | 0.97% | 39,023,888 | |
| 2,025,284 | Institution | 0.95% | 38,257,615 | |
| 1,606,270 | Institution | 0.75% | 30,342,440 | |
| 1,264,800 | Institution | 0.59% | 23,892,072 | |
| 1,148,427 | Institution | 0.54% | 21,693,786 | |
| 1,067,658 | Institution | 0.50% | 20,168,060 | |
| 992,134 | Institution | 0.46% | 18,741,411 | 
| Holder | # of Shares | Type | % Holding | Value | 
|---|---|---|---|---|
| 6,701,008 | Institution | 3.13% | 131,607,797 | |
| 5,152,878 | Institution | 2.41% | 101,202,524 | |
| 4,440,738 | Institution | 2.08% | 83,885,541 | |
| 4,266,065 | Institution | 1.99% | 83,785,517 | |
| 2,875,626 | Institution | 1.34% | 56,477,295 | |
| 2,268,441 | Institution | 1.06% | 44,552,181 | |
| 1,626,792 | Institution | 0.76% | 30,730,101 | |
| 936,616 | Institution | 0.44% | 17,233,734 | |
| 881,739 | Institution | 0.41% | 17,317,354 | |
| 619,683 | Institution | 0.29% | 11,705,812 |